Output 60d95f7b39d11345e538f9c6d0c709c20931547a1ce3f363610ee65a9e5f0ffb:1

value
322730907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9eb7af54bc83465ebeefa379934c6227bfd2ad7 OP_EQUAL
address
3P1sThUfzBZKm2eRqR94Xgyq9tXtiWwFiH
transaction
60d95f7b39d11345e538f9c6d0c709c20931547a1ce3f363610ee65a9e5f0ffb
confirmations
452783
spent
true